1 |
Jesus
summoned His twelve disciples and gave them authority over unclean spirits,
to cast them out, and to heal every kind of disease and every kind of
sickness.
|
|
|
2 |
Now the
names of the twelve apostles are these: The first, Simon, who is called
Peter, and Andrew his brother; and James the son of Zebedee, and John his
brother;
|
|
3 |
Philip
and Bartholomew; Thomas and Matthew the tax collector; James the son of
Alphaeus, and Thaddaeus;
|
|
4 |
Simon
the Zealot, and Judas Iscariot, the one who betrayed Him. |
|
5 |
These twelve Jesus sent out after instructing them:
“Do not go in the way of the Gentiles, and do not enter any
city of the Samaritans;
|
|
6 |
but rather go to the lost sheep of the house of Israel. |
|
7 |
“And as you go, preach, saying, ‘The kingdom of heaven is at
hand.’
|
|
8 |
“Heal the sick, raise the dead, cleanse the lepers, cast out
demons. Freely you received, freely give.
|
|
9 |
“Do not acquire gold, or silver, or copper for your money
belts, |
|
10 |
or a bag for your journey, or even two coats, or sandals, or a
staff; for the worker is worthy of his support.
|
|
11 |
“And whatever city or village you enter, inquire who is worthy
in it, and stay at his house until you leave that city.
|
|
12 |
“As you enter the house, give it your greeting. |
|
13 |
“If the house is worthy, give it your blessing of peace. But
if it is not worthy, take back your blessing of peace.
|
|
14 |
“Whoever does not receive you, nor heed your words, as you go
out of that house or that city, shake the dust off your feet.
|
|
15 |
“Truly I say to you, it will be more tolerable for the land of
Sodom and Gomorrah in the day of judgment than for that city.
|
|
16 |
“Behold, I send you out as sheep in the midst of wolves; so be
shrewd as serpents and innocent as doves.
|
|
17 |
“But beware of men, for they will hand you over to the courts
and scourge you in their synagogues;
|
|
18 |
and you will even be brought before governors and kings for My
sake, as a testimony to them and to the Gentiles.
|
|
19 |
“But when they hand you over, do not worry about how or what
you are to say; for it will be given you in that hour what you are to say.
|
|
20 |
“For it is not you who speak, but it is the Spirit of your
Father who speaks in you.
|
|
21 |
“Brother will betray brother to death, and a father his child;
and children will rise up against parents and cause them to be put to death.
|
|
22 |
“You will be hated by all because of My name, but it is the one
who has endured to the end who will be saved.
|
|
23 |
“But whenever they persecute you in one city, flee to the next;
for truly I say to you, you will not finish going through the cities of
Israel until the Son of Man comes.
|
|
24 |
“A disciple is not above his teacher, nor a slave above his
master. |
|
25 |
“It is enough for the disciple that he become like his teacher,
and the slave like his master. If they have called the head of the house
Beelzebul, how much more will they malign the members of his household!
|
|
26 |
“Therefore do not fear them, for there is nothing concealed
that will not be revealed, or hidden that will not be known.
|
|
27 |
“What I tell you in the darkness, speak in the light; and what
you hear whispered in your ear, proclaim upon the housetops.
|
|
28 |
“Do not fear those who kill the body but are unable to kill the
soul; but rather fear Him who is able to destroy both soul and body in hell.
|
|
29 |
“Are not two sparrows sold for a cent? And yet not one of them
will fall to the ground apart from your Father.
|
|
30 |
“But the very hairs of your head are all numbered. |
|
31 |
“So do not fear; you are more valuable than many sparrows. |
|
32 |
“Therefore everyone who confesses Me before men, I will also
confess him before My Father who is in heaven.
|
|
33 |
“But whoever denies Me before men, I will also deny him before
My Father who is in heaven.
|
|
34 |
“Do not think that I came to bring peace on the earth; I did
not come to bring peace, but a sword.
|
|
35 |
“For I came to SET A MAN AGAINST HIS FATHER, AND A DAUGHTER
AGAINST HER MOTHER, AND A DAUGHTER-IN-LAW AGAINST HER MOTHER-IN-LAW;
|
|
36 |
and A MAN’S ENEMIES WILL BE THE MEMBERS OF HIS HOUSEHOLD. |
|
37 |
“He who loves father or mother more than Me is not worthy of
Me; and he who loves son or daughter more than Me is not worthy of Me.
|
|
38 |
“And he who does not take his cross and follow after Me is not
worthy of Me.
|
|
39 |
“He who has found his life will lose it, and he who has lost
his life for My sake will find it.
|
|
40 |
“He who receives you receives Me, and he who receives Me
receives Him who sent Me.
|
|
41 |
“He who receives a prophet in the name of a prophet shall
receive a prophet’s reward; and he who receives a righteous man in the name
of a righteous man shall receive a righteous man’s reward.
|
|
42 |
“And whoever in the name of a disciple gives to one of these
little ones even a cup of cold water to drink, truly I say to you, he shall
not lose his reward.”
